Dwight Edgar Curtiss, Sr, taken in Germany at the German Air Base where Dwight Edgar Curtiss was stationed. He was Army Air Corp and was in Germany right as the war ended, so 1945/46 is our guess. He was in charge of the occupied air field, and talked about how they had to destroy the German planes by pulling them apart with tanks and cables. He talked about how the bombed buildings still had corpses in them and the smell from them. Also, how Dwight would take extra bread and butter and give it to the Germans who would grab scraps of food as the US soldiers were cleaning off their plates after eating; starving Germans.
